Background technique
Plastic cement products, which process raw material, is mainly divided into thermoplasticity and thermosetting plastic according to the molecular structure of synthetic resin: right Refer in thermoplastic plastic and heat still plastic plastic cement repeatedly, mainly there is PE/PP/PVC/PS/ABS/PMMA/POM/PC/PA Etc. common raw material.Thermosetting plastic be primarily referred to as heat hardening synthetic resin it is obtained plastic cement, as some phenolic aldehyde plastic cement and Amino plastic cement.
Currently, plastic cement products process raw material, particle is likely to be mixed into miscellaneous during production, packaging, transport and dismantling Matter, existing exclusion device is mostly filtered large volume of impurity using sieve, to the micro metal in feed particles Grain cannot be removed effectively, while the dust in feed particles can not also clean.Therefore it is proposed that a kind of plastic cement products add Work impurity removing device.

Compared with prior art, the utility model has the beneficial effects that
1, flow to feed particles on conveyer belt by deflector, the magnetic particle in conveyer belt is by the gold in feed particles Belong to impurity to be sucked, then the scraper by being bonded on the left of conveyer belt scrapes metal impurities, metal impurities are arranged by impurity drainage conduit Out, effectively the metal impurities in feed particles are excluded, improves the quality of feed particles;
It 2, can when feed particles are poured by feed inlet by the nozzle installed on the blower ventilation pipe on the left of cabinet Dust in feed particles is blown afloat, then is sucked dust in disposal box by the suction nozzle on the cleaner pipe on the right side of cabinet, Effectively the dust in feed particles is discharged, improves the quality of feed particles;
3, the structure design of the utility model is reasonable, and sieve can compare the big larger impurity of feed particles and carry out screening row It removes, there is social utility's value, be worthy to be popularized.

Working principle: in use, the plastic cement products particle that processes raw material is poured by feed inlet 3, by feed inlet 3 Sieve 21 screens large volume of impurity and excludes, the nozzle 14 installed on 12 ventilation duct 13 of blower by 2 left side of cabinet, When feed particles are poured by feed inlet 3, the dust in feed particles can be blown afloat, then pass through the dust catcher 15 on 2 right side of cabinet Suction nozzle 17 on conduit 16 sucks dust in disposal box 18, flows to feed particles on conveyer belt 6 by deflector 23, conveys The metal impurities in feed particles are sucked with the magnetic particle 7 in 6, then the scraper 11 by being bonded on the left of conveyer belt 6 will be golden Belong to impurity to scrape, metal impurities are called in the first V-type unloading house 24 and are discharged by impurity drainage conduit 19, and feed particles then pass through right side The distance between conveyer belt 6 and 2 inner wall of cabinet fall into the second V-type unloading house 25, are discharged by raw material drainage conduit 20.
